When choosing a bain marie warmer for a food truck, several factors come into play that can affect your daily operations and long-term investment. Understanding these considerations can help you avoid common pitfalls, such as overpaying for features you don’t need or selecting a unit too small for your demand. Here are key factors to keep in mind:Capacity and Size
Capacity directly impacts how many dishes you can keep warm simultaneously, which is crucial for busy food trucks. Larger units with more pans or bigger tanks are ideal for high-volume service but tend to be heavier and less portable. Conversely, compact models are easier to store and move but may restrict your menu size or serving capacity. Think about your typical customer flow and menu size before choosing a size that balances convenience with functionality.
Build Quality and Materials
Stainless steel is widely regarded as the best material for bain marie warmers because it resists rust, is easy to clean, and withstands frequent use. Cheaper plastic or thin metals may save money upfront but can compromise durability and hygiene. A well-built unit reduces maintenance costs and ensures consistent performance, especially important in the demanding environment of a food truck.
Temperature Control and Safety Features
Precise temperature controls, including adjustable thermostats, help maintain food at safe, optimal temperatures. Additional safety features like anti-dry burn protection and drain taps simplify operation and cleaning, reducing risks of accidents or food spoilage. Choosing a model with these features can improve efficiency and safety during busy service times.
Power Consumption and Compatibility
Wattage determines how quickly your bain marie heats up and how much energy it consumes. For food trucks that rely on limited power sources, it’s essential to select a unit compatible with your electrical setup. Overpowered models may draw too much current, causing circuit overloads, while underpowered units might not reach desired temperatures fast enough.
Price and Long-Term Value
While budget models can be tempting, investing in a high-quality, durable bain marie can pay off over time through reduced repairs and better performance. Consider the total cost of ownership, including maintenance and energy efficiency. Sometimes, paying a premium for a reliable unit means fewer disruptions during busy service hours, ultimately supporting smoother operations.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do I choose the right capacity for my food truck?
Capacity depends on your expected customer volume and menu complexity. If you serve a high number of customers daily, a larger unit with multiple pans or bigger tanks ensures you can keep all your dishes warm without constant refilling. For smaller or more specialized menus, a compact model might suffice and offer greater portability. Consider your peak service times and typical order sizes when making this decision.
Is stainless steel construction worth the extra cost?
Yes, stainless steel is generally worth the investment because of its durability, ease of cleaning, and resistance to rust and corrosion. These qualities make it ideal for the frequent, often messy environment of a food truck. Cheaper materials may save money upfront but can require more frequent replacements or repairs, which could increase costs over time.
What safety features should I look for in a bain marie warmer?
Look for units with anti-dry burn protection, which prevents damage if water runs out, and drain taps that simplify cleaning and reduce spills. Adjustable thermostats are also critical for maintaining safe food temperatures. Safety features not only protect your equipment but also help prevent food safety issues, making them essential for busy food trucks.
Can I use a standard household outlet for a commercial bain marie?
Most commercial bain marie warmers require higher wattage than typical household outlets can provide, especially models rated at 1500W or more. Check the product specifications and your truck’s electrical capacity before purchasing. If your outlet cannot support the unit’s power demands, you may need to upgrade your electrical system or choose a lower-wattage model to avoid circuit overloads.
How important is energy efficiency for a food truck warmer?
Energy efficiency is important because it can significantly affect your running costs, especially if you operate for long hours daily. An energy-efficient model heats quickly and maintains temperature with less power, reducing utility bills. Additionally, lower energy consumption can decrease the load on your electrical system, helping prevent circuit issues and ensuring smooth operation during busy hours.
